Key Facts:

  • We see on average 4810 OP appointments a day.
  • We are the 4th busiest Trauma & Orthopaedic outpatients department in England – an average of 2077 per week.
  • An average of 1115 patients are seen in A&Es across our network every day – 3rd largest in the country.
  • Our hospitals admit an average of 195 emergency patients daily.
  • Last year we undertook almost 33,700 planned surgical operations in our 57 operating theatres.
  • We are one of only 7 Trusts nationally with more than 50 operating theatres.
  • We carry out more than 140 elective procedures each working day.
  • UHDB is a research active University Hospital with a large and varied portfolio of clinical trials and research opportunities for all staff.

Swydd-ddisgrifiad a phrif gyfrifoldebau manwl

Please see attached Job description and Person Specification. 

This position is offered on a flexible basis.

•Support patient’s use of EC equipment by regularly reviewing them and their equipment requirements so as to meet changing needs and enable them to maintain a degree of independence
•To participate with the provision of other EAT with the integration of other specialties such as communication aids, powered wheelchair controls and other equipment of daily living, where this is appropriate.
•To collaborate with other clinical services and social agencies to optimise patient’s wellbeing.
•To ensure that patients and carers are well informed on the use of the equipment that has been loaned to them.
•To adapt equipment provision to meet the changing needs of the patient.
•To ensure adequate and relevant level of competency, including awareness of technological developments
•To promote the development and application of EC and other relevant EAT
•Consult with the Clinical Scientists and engineers from the contracted companies to ensure that the most appropriate cost-effective solutions are installed for clients.
•To maintain accurate, comprehensive and up-to-date documentation, in line with legal, professional and Trust requirements.
•Understand the use of computer hardware and software to deliver support to patients with computer access requirements.
•To engage in lifelong learning through an active CPD program.
